        local.users - Specifies mail recipients on the local host.
        The local.users file contains a list of user  names  whose
       mail is to be delivered to the local host and whose return
       address is username@hostname.  Entries in the  local.hosts
       file  are  in  addition to other local users (such as root
       and postmaster). See sendmail.cf(4) for a  description  of
       other local users.
       You can add entries to this file if the host is configured
       as a simple client and either of the  following  is  true:
       The user wants their mail delivered on this machine rather
       than being forwarded to the mail server.  You  are  adding
       aliases  to  the  /var/adm/sendmail/aliases file. When the
       host is configured as a simple client, the alias  must  be
       added to this file and the aliases file.
       A  simple  client  is  defined as a host that had the mail
       system configured using the  MailConfig  application  from
       the  System  Management  utilities or configured using the
       mailsetup utility's Quick Setup menu.
       The format of the file is as follows: User names are separated
  by  blanks or new lines.  Multiple user name can be
       specified on a line.  Blank lines are ignored.  A  comment
       mark (#) ends the line.
       After modifying the local.users file, you must restart the
       sendmail daemon to apply the changes.  Use  the  following
       command: # /sbin/init.d/sendmail restart
       root  postmaster  rw   #  A comment followed by an ignored
       blank line.
       # Another comment.  mariah    # Another comment.
          carey  # Leading blanks are acceptable.
